## Bouncewright 3.2 — Changed Defaults

Heads up: the bounce processor now classifies soft bounces after 3 retries instead of 5, and suppression-list entries expire after 90 days by default. Hard bounces suppress immediately, same as before. If a client relied on the old retry window, override per-tenant; don't edit globals. The queue poller interval also dropped from 60s to 30s, so expect faster feedback in the dashboard. The current production defaults are listed below.

config for kagup-hahig:
druwyn:
  pin: 2801
  metrics_host: metrics.druwyn.zemvarlabs.internal
  tenant: sorius
  seal: seal_798a43d7

# Limits & Quotas — Relevance Tuning

Search relevance experiments on Quillfind are capped per reviewer: one active boost profile per index, max five staged changes. Boost multipliers are clamped server-side; anything outside bounds is silently truncated, so check logs. Reranking depth is fixed to protect latency budgets. All clamps and depths come from one config block, reproduced below.

tuning table, hafog-bahaf:
QUOTAS = {
    "praion": 144,
    "briax": 906,
    "silwyn": 451,
}

Hey Marisol — handing off Gridweaver for the week. The crossword generator is mostly stable, but the clue-dedup pass occasionally hangs on puzzles over 21x21. If it does, just restart the worker; state is checkpointed. Don't touch the dictionary loader, Tobin is mid-refactor on it. Nightly batch runs at 02:00 and usually finishes in twenty minutes. Everything else you need, including escalation steps and known quirks, lives on the internal page here:

dashboard of kafof-tahaf = https://confluence.tolvaqsys.internal/projects/browse/display/a1250987